## Step 4: Swap the renderer

Replace the old Inkfall markdown renderer with the Parchmint pipeline. Delete the legacy plugin directory first — leftover plugins will double-render footnotes. The new pipeline runs sanitization before extension hooks, so any custom extensions that relied on raw HTML passthrough must be updated or removed. Run the fixture suite against the sample corpus before promoting; diffs in heading anchors are expected and safe. Once the fixtures pass, point the build at the new renderer config, reproduced below.

service settings:
[casax]
port = 6379
team = rusir
host = casax.zemvarhq.corp
region = outer-4
access_code = ac_9808ce
timeout_ms = 1500

KeyMill is Dornvale's internal secrets-rotation utility. It rotates database credentials and service tokens on a 14-day cycle, writing new values to the vault before revoking old ones. Rotation runs are idempotent and logged to the audit stream. For this week's sync demo, the dry-run endpoint accepts the token below.

portal login ticket: eyJhbGciOiJIUzI1NiIsInR5cCI6IkpXVCJ9.eyJzdWIiOiIwEOsktwVNwIn0.-UJU3fdyyCgG

Shrinkjaw is Corvel Labs' CLI for batch image resizing, used by external plugin authors to regenerate asset sets. Normal plugin credentials cannot invoke the production resize farm. If a release is blocked and no maintainer is reachable, break-glass access grants a four-hour elevated token. Every break-glass use is logged, flagged, and reviewed at the next maintainer sync. Abuse results in plugin delisting. The elevated token vault sits at the root of the partner console; open it with the recovery passphrase below.

unlock words, fafop-hawep: briwyn-oliix-sorox

Runbook: Plover Address Autocomplete Widget

If suggestions stop rendering: check the widget's init callback fired before DOM ready — race condition is the usual cause. Rate limiting returns an empty array, not an error; handle both. Stale region data clears with a cache-bust query param. Do not retry failed lookups more than twice; the gateway throttles aggressively. Versioned embed snippets and the deprecation schedule are maintained on the page below.

runbook for baguf-bawip: https://jira.qorvelsys.internal/pages/pages/pages/browse/1853